I've used MPO in the past but not for years now. I have received scrappers from them but I have also received authentic pins from them. I just kept the scrappers and didn't trade them. They also send Pro Pins which are tradeable with CM's but most other guests won't take them in trade. I like Pro Pins but not everyone does. You can search your pins on pinpics .com that site will have pictures of the pins and information from other traders regarding possible scrappers.

What's a "scrapper"? Im assuming that means it is a fake pin? I recently ordered a 50 ct grab bag from a seller on ebay because my kids decided they wanted to start pin trading this year. (They are doing chores to earn these over the summer!) How can I tell if they are all legit? The listing guaranteed they were all tradable. Thanks so much!
 
Follow the link in my signature for a thread about eBay and pins. You can find some good sellers there, also some not so good. Also, on the Collector's Board is a list of ways to tell if you have good or possible scrapper pins. For me, a red flag is a seller who says they are tradeable, technically even scrappers are tradeable.
